- VeneersVeneers - The application of a laboratory manufactured color-matched layer of porcelein that is bonded to the visible surface of existing teeth. Veneers are sometimes useful for correcting large defects and are often used for closing spaces between teeth and to repair teeth with large chipped surfaces. Veneers are also a means of whitening teeth.

- BridgesWhen one or more teeth have a large old filling, are fractured, severely damaged by decay, or missing, we may recommend the placement of a crown (cap) or a bridge. A crown strengthens, restores and protects a single tooth while a bridge replaces one or more missing teeth. Crowns and bridges are anchored using a special adhesive and are not removable.

- Root Canal TreatmentPorcelain Crowns and Bridges - Porcelain Crowns are restorations which are placed over your entire tooth and often provide the best long-term solutions for severe problems. Teeth which have had root canal treetment, severe fractures or large fillings may require crowns. Porcelain bridges may be neccesary in situations where one or several teeth are mising. Porcelain teeth (pontics) replace the missing teeth and are connected to two or more crowns.

- Dental ImplantsMost dental implants are titanium cylinders that are surgically placed into the jawbone by an oral surgeon. The bone bonds to the implants over a period of several months through a process called osseointegration.
- Teeth WhiteningWhitening - Treating the teeth with a special gel that reacts with the enamel and results in a whiter coloration. There are both in-office and at-home variations of this treatment.
